Indiana Statutes
§ 9-32-19-30 — Indemnification
Indiana·Title 9 MOTOR VEHICLES·Art. 32 DEALER SERVICES·Ch. 19 Recreational Vehicle Dealer Agreements
(a)Notwithstanding the terms of a
recreational vehicle dealer agreement, a warrantor may not fail to
indemnify, defend, and hold harmless a recreational vehicle dealer
against any losses or damages to the extent the losses or damages are
caused by the negligence or willful misconduct of the warrantor.
(b)A recreational vehicle dealer may not be denied indemnification
or a defense for failing to discover, disclose, or remedy a defect in the
design or manufacture of the recreational vehicle.
(c)A recreational vehicle dealer may not fail to indemnify, defend,
and hold harmless the warrantor against any losses or damages to the
extent such losses or damages are caused by the negligence or willful
misconduct of the recreational vehicle dealer.
